Newport City Council intends to make an Experimental Order to introduce a temporary speed limit on sections of the South Distributor Road from February 22, 2021, for a period of 18 months during which time it will be reviewed. The following lengths of road will be subject to a 40mph speed limit: A48 SDR (eastbound carriageway) from a point 100 metres northeast of its junction with the Transporter Bridge access road to a point 115 metres west of its junction with the centre line of the northbound carriageway of A4042 Usk Way
